IndexMate is designed to process much of your site and SEO data on your device. Depending on your usage, audit results, submission logs, and site configurations may be stored locally rather than on our servers.
Purpose: To support local-first operation, reduce unnecessary data transfer, and give you greater control over sensitive site information.

When you use index submission or related features, IndexMate may send URLs and related metadata to third-party search engine services at your direction, including but not limited to:
Those services are governed by their own privacy policies and terms. We encourage you to review them before connecting your accounts.
We may also use infrastructure and analytics providers to host the website, process payments, or measure usage. These providers are permitted to process data only as needed to perform services on our behalf.
We implement reasonable technical and organizational safeguards, including access controls and encryption where appropriate, to protect your information.
However, no method of transmission over the Internet or electronic storage is completely secure. You are responsible for safeguarding your account credentials and any API keys you configure in the application.
